What Are Prescription-Free Drugs?
Prescription-free drugs are medications that can be acquired without a prescription. These drugs are considered safe and reliable for treating minor health problems when used according to the instructions supplied. They are normally categorized into 2 primary classifications:

OTC (Over-The-Counter) Medications: These are drugs that can be bought straight from pharmacies, supermarket, and other retail outlets. They are typically utilized for the treatment of mild disorders, such as headaches, colds, or allergies.

Dietary Supplements: These consist of vitamins, minerals, herbs, and other nutritional supplements. While they are not drugs in the standard sense, they offer health advantages and can be bought without a prescription.

Threats and Considerations
While prescription-free drugs featured many advantages, users need to likewise exercise caution. Here are some potential risks:

Misuse: Individuals might abuse OTC medications, causing adverse impacts or drug interactions.

Self-Diagnosis: Relying on self-diagnosis can result in inaccurate treatment choices and potentially worsen health problems.

Negative effects: Even OTC medications can cause adverse effects or allergies, especially if consumers do not read the labels carefully.

Inadequate Treatment: Some conditions might require prescription medications for efficient treatment, and overlooking this can result in complications.

2. Can prescription-free drugs engage with prescription medications?
Yes, lots of OTC drugs can engage with prescription medications, possibly causing negative results. It is necessary to notify health care providers about all medications being taken.
3. How do I know if an OTC drug is ideal for my symptoms?
Understanding your symptoms and researching suitable OTC choices can assist. However, speaking with a pharmacist or doctor for recommendations is always helpful.
4. Are dietary supplements considered safe?
Many dietary supplements are usually safe, but their efficacy can vary. It is essential to research products and seek advice from a doctor, particularly for those with pre-existing health conditions.
5. Is it required to keep an eye on the expiration dates of OTC drugs?
Yes, ended medications might lose their efficiency and could potentially be damaging. Regularly examine expiration dates and safely get rid of ended products.
